Where Can I Find Legitimate Seattle VPS Coupon Codes?
The most reliable sources for legitimate coupon codes are the official channels of the hosting provider itself. These include the provider's primary website, dedicated promotions or deals pages, and official email newsletters. Codes distributed here are directly tied to current, active campaigns.
When searching, focus on promotions that explicitly mention VPS products and, if available, the Seattle region. Be skeptical of codes from generic coupon aggregator sites, as they often list expired, region-specific, or heavily conditioned offers. Always treat any third-party code as suspect until you can verify it against the provider's official terms.
Why Is Choosing a Seattle VPS Location a Strategic Move?
Selecting Seattle as your VPS location is a decision based on network geography and performance optimization. Seattle is a major West Coast connectivity hub with direct access to transpacific submarine cables, offering inherently low-latency paths to users in the Pacific Northwest, Western Canada, and key Asian tech markets. For projects targeting these audiences, the physical proximity reduces data travel time, directly improving application response times and website loading speeds.
This performance advantage adds tangible value to your investment, especially when combined with a discount. When evaluating a coupon, always confirm that the savings apply to a server in the Seattle data center, as a discount on a distant location may undermine your project's performance goals.
Understanding Coupon Types and Their Real Value
Not all discounts are created equal. The value of a coupon is defined by its terms, not just its headline percentage. Here is a comparison of common promotional structures:
| Coupon Type | Typical Requirement | Best For | Key Consideration |
|---|---|---|---|
| First-Term Discount (e.g., 50% off 1st month) | New customers, initial purchase only | Trialing a new service with low upfront risk | No long-term savings; standard price resumes afterward. |
| Percentage Off (e.g., 15% off) | Prepaid commitment (3-12 months) | Securing a better rate on a stable, long-term workload | Requires significant upfront capital; discount may not apply to renewals. |
| Flat-Rate Discount (e.g., $50 off) | Annual prepayment | Maximizing savings on high-value annual plans | Large initial outlay; less flexibility if needs change. |
| Free Upgrade | Selecting a specific plan tier | Obtaining more resources (e.g., extra RAM) for the same price | Upgrade may be temporary or feature-limited. |
| Recurring Discount | Multi-year commitment | Achieving lower ongoing costs for predictable projects | Often locked to a specific billing cycle; plan changes can be complex. |
What Critical Coupon Terms Should You Evaluate?
Before applying any code, you must dissect its terms to understand the actual commitment and savings. Ignoring these details can lead to unexpected costs or a renewal shock.
Essential Terms to Check:
- Product Eligibility: Does the code work for all VPS configurations, or only for specific tiers, operating systems, or locations like Seattle?
- Discount Scope: Is the discount applied only to the first invoice, or is it a recurring discount applied to every billing cycle? This distinction dramatically changes the long-term value.
- Billing Cycle Mandate: Most promotions require you to prepay for a longer period (e.g., quarterly, annually) to unlock the discount. A low monthly price may be contingent on a 12-month commitment.
- Customer Status: Is the coupon restricted to new customers only, or can existing customers use it for renewals, upgrades, or new services?
- Expiration Date: Nearly all coupons have a strict validity period. Using one after it expires will fail at checkout.

How Do You Verify a Coupon Was Applied Correctly?
Verification is a two-step process. First, during checkout, the order summary must clearly display a line item for the promotion, showing a negative amount that reduces your total due. Never proceed to payment without seeing this confirmation.
Second, after purchase, review the invoice within your account dashboard. The same discount should appear on your official billing record. If the discount is missing from either the checkout summary or the post-purchase invoice, contact the provider's support team immediately with your order details for resolution.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use a Seattle VPS coupon code on an existing server renewal?
This is entirely dependent on the coupon's specific terms. Many promotions are designed for new acquisitions only and cannot be applied to renewals. However, some providers offer loyalty discounts or recurring promotional rates. You must check the fine print of each individual coupon to confirm its applicability to renewals.
Do Seattle VPS coupon codes usually expire?
Yes, almost all promotional codes have a set expiration date. They are tied to marketing campaigns (like Black Friday or seasonal sales) or limited-time offers. Always look for an "Expires On" or "Valid Until" date in the promotion's details.
What if my coupon code doesn't work at checkout?
First, check for typos. Next, review the coupon's terms against your cart: Are you purchasing the correct product type? Does your plan meet the minimum configuration or prepaid period required? The code may also be region-specific or already expired. If you've verified all terms and it still fails, contact the provider's sales support for assistance.
Is there a limit to how many times a coupon can be used?
Some coupons are unlimited, but many are single-use per customer or have a total global redemption cap. Once a public coupon reaches its usage limit, it will no longer function. The terms will typically indicate if there is a usage limit.
